XC Open source finite element analysis program
XC::Metis Member List

This is the complete list of members for XC::Metis, including all inherited members.

activateParameter(int parameterID) (defined in XC::MovableObject)XC::MovableObjectvirtual
DistributedBase(void)XC::DistributedBase
DOF_Numberer (defined in XC::Metis)XC::Metisfriend
getClassTag(void) const XC::MovableObject
getCopy(void) const (defined in XC::Metis)XC::Metisprotectedvirtual
getDbTag(void) const XC::MovableObject
getDbTag(CommParameters &)XC::MovableObject
getDbTagData(void) const XC::DistributedBasevirtual
getDbTagDataPos(const int &i) const XC::DistributedBase
getVariable(const std::string &variable, Information &) (defined in XC::MovableObject)XC::MovableObjectvirtual
GraphNumberer(int classTag) (defined in XC::GraphNumberer)XC::GraphNumbererprotected
GraphPartitioner(void) (defined in XC::GraphPartitioner)XC::GraphPartitionerinlineprotected
inicComm(const int &dataSize) const XC::DistributedBase
Metis(void) (defined in XC::Metis)XC::Metisprotected
Metis(int Ptype, int Mtype, int coarsenTo, int Rtype, int IPtype) (defined in XC::Metis)XC::Metisprotected
MovableObject(int classTag, int dbTag)XC::MovableObject
MovableObject(int classTag)XC::MovableObject
MovableObject(const MovableObject &otro)XC::MovableObject
number(Graph &theGraph, int lastVertex=-1) (defined in XC::Metis)XC::Metisvirtual
number(Graph &theGraph, const ID &lastVertices) (defined in XC::Metis)XC::Metisvirtual
operator=(const MovableObject &otro)XC::MovableObject
partition(Graph &theGraph, int numPart)XC::Metisvirtual
partition(Graph &theGraph, int numPart) (defined in XC::Metis)XC::Metisvirtual
partitionGraph(int *nvtxs, int *xadj, int *adjncy, int *vwgt, int *adjwgt, int *wgtflag, int *numflag, int *nparts, int *options, int *edgecut, int *part, bool whichToUse) (defined in XC::Metis)XC::Metis
partitionHexMesh(int *elmnts, int *epart, int *npart, int ne, int nn, int nparts, bool whichToUse) (defined in XC::Metis)XC::Metis
recvSelf(const CommParameters &) (defined in XC::Metis)XC::Metisvirtual
sendSelf(CommParameters &) (defined in XC::Metis)XC::Metisvirtual
setDbTag(int dbTag)XC::MovableObject
setDbTag(CommParameters &)XC::MovableObject
setDbTagDataPos(const int &i, const int &v)XC::DistributedBase
setDefaultOptions(void) (defined in XC::Metis)XC::Metis
setDefaultOptions(void) (defined in XC::Metis)XC::Metis
setOptions(int Ptype, int Mtype, int coarsenTo, int Rtype, int IPtype) (defined in XC::Metis)XC::Metis
setOptions(int Ptype, int Mtype, int coarsenTo, int Rtype, int IPtype) (defined in XC::Metis)XC::Metis
setParameter(const std::vector< std::string > &argv, Parameter &param) (defined in XC::MovableObject)XC::MovableObjectvirtual
setVariable(const std::string &variable, Information &)XC::MovableObjectvirtual
updateParameter(int parameterID, Information &info) (defined in XC::MovableObject)XC::MovableObjectvirtual
~GraphNumberer(void) (defined in XC::GraphNumberer)XC::GraphNumbererinlinevirtual